So every school that has a new basketball coach should expect a National Championship by year 5? Only Kentucky, Florida and Arkansas have won National Championships with the most recent being nearly 10 years ago. Until very recently, the SEC was an afterthought besides Kentucky for being a dominant basketball conference.
I've only been following College Basketball for 50 years and have rarely seen such a phenomena of a new coach putting together a champion within five years. There's a a lot of truth to the belief of "Blue Bloods" in College Basketball. I'm not sure Baylor has reached that "blue blood" level as yet. Its only been a couple of years since Gonzaga has been so recognized and they've been winning a massive quantity of their games [facing extensive non-conference opponents] for nearly two decades. And they have yet to win a National Championship. This simply isn't the equivalent of the SEC West which dominates college football year in and year out.
